WebSep 23, 2024 · Canvas is a popular choice for sublimation because it is both durable and has a high heat tolerance. However, there are a few things to keep in mind when sublimating on canvas. First, the canvas must be stretched tight on a frame before being subjected to the high temperatures of the sublimation process. WebJun 27, 2024 · If we look at the canvas sublimation, it is the process of sublimating your desired image on a canvas by using your regular heat press setting (380-420° F). We stretch the canvas on stretcher bars. In the end, a vibrant and attractive canvas print is generated. The same process is used to get personalized images.
